United Arab Emirates to Somalia visa requirements

UAE ordinary passport holders need an eVisa/eTAS to visit federal Somalia. Somalia's 2025 eTAS notice exempts Rwanda and Malaysia from visas and keeps visa on arrival for listed countries, but the UAE is not on either list, so UAE travelers should obtain the electronic authorization before departure. As of 2026, United Arab Emirates ordinary passport holders are NOT visa-free for federal Somalia and must obtain a Somalia eVisa/eTAS before traveling. Somali Civil Aviation Authority AIC A 10/2025 states that, from 1 September 2025, foreign passport holders must possess a valid eTA to enter Somalia unless exempt. The same official notice lists visa-free passports from Rwanda and Malaysia and visa-on-arrival eligibility for Ethiopia, Burundi, Djibouti, Mauritania, Tanzania, Uganda, Algeria, Libya, Tunisia, Egypt, and Comoros; the UAE is not in those lists. Applicants should apply at the official portal (evisa.gov.so / etas.gov.so), upload a passport valid at least six months with a blank page plus a photo/selfie, and provide accommodation, sponsor or Letter of Guarantee details, and onward-travel details if requested by the portal. Official public sources confirm that applicants pay the applicable non-refundable fee online but do not publish a stable current fee or guaranteed processing time, so travelers should check the portal at payment and apply well in advance. The approved eVisa/eTAS arrives by email as a PDF and must be presented to the airline and to immigration on arrival. Note: Somaliland (Hargeisa) operates its own separate visa system. Somalia is not part of the Schengen area, so the Schengen 90/180 rule and ETIAS do not apply. Given that UAE ordinary passports are not exempt and not listed for Somalia visa on arrival, the verdict is eVisa.

/02 — The process

How to apply

/01
Confirm passport validity
Ensure your UAE ordinary passport is valid for at least six months beyond your planned arrival date in Somalia and has at least one blank page.
· 6+ months validity· 1 blank page
/02
Open the official eVisa portal
Go to the Somali Immigration and Citizenship Agency eVisa/eTAS portal at evisa.gov.so (or etas.gov.so). Avoid unofficial third-party sites that add markups.
· evisa.gov.so· Official ICA portal
/03
Complete the online application
Fill in personal and passport details, travel purpose (tourism/short visit), arrival airport, accommodation contact in Somalia, and sponsor or Letter of Guarantee details if requested by the portal.
· Tourism purpose· Accommodation· Sponsor details
/04
Upload documents
Upload a scan of your passport bio page and a recent passport photo or selfie as specified by the portal.
· Passport scan· Photo/selfie
/05
Pay the eVisa fee
Pay the applicable non-refundable fee shown by the official portal with an accepted online payment method.
· Online payment· Non-refundable
/06
Receive and print the eVisa
Wait for approval by email, then download the PDF eVisa. Print it and carry it to present to the airline at check-in and to immigration on arrival.

/06 — The risks

Common refusal reasons

by frequency
/01
Mandatory eTAS applies to UAE ordinary passports
Somalia's AIC A 10/2025 requires foreign passport holders to have an eTA unless exempt; UAE ordinary passports are not listed among the visa-free or visa-on-arrival exemptions.
High
/02
Visa on arrival exists only for listed countries
The official AIC keeps visa on arrival for countries such as Djibouti, Ethiopia, Burundi, Mauritania, Tanzania, Uganda, Algeria, Libya, Tunisia, Egypt, and Comoros, but not the UAE.
High
/03
Passport not valid 6 months / no blank page
Applications and entry can be refused if the passport does not meet the six-month validity and blank-page requirements.
Medium
/04
Applying via unofficial sites
Using non-government portals can lead to inflated fees or fraud; apply only on evisa.gov.so / etas.gov.so.
Medium
/05
Confusing Somaliland with federal Somalia
Hargeisa (Somaliland) runs a separate visa regime; the federal eVisa does not cover entry there.
